Learn How To Train A Dog, Without Difficulty, Using Puppy Crate Training.

Kennel Training A Puppy, described by many as Puppy Crate Training, is the easiest way to get started with house breaking the new pup you have just got as a pet. 'Kennel' may be referred to as 'Crate' or 'Cage', and 'Kennel Training' or 'Cage Training' could be referred to as 'Crate Training' in what follows, in this article.

There are other added benefits to a dog kennel, aside from only house breaking puppies. While kept in a kennel, the dog is not able to do any mischief and hurt itself. Remember that, your costly boots will not be chewed up. Kennel Training A Puppy, if executed properly, will also give you a secure 'den', where your dog will always be well protected.

To a pooch in the wild, it's den is the place it feels comfortable in, it seeks asylum in, it goes to, in order to relax. The concept of kennel training a puppy is to use the kennel as the den it would have sought out, in the event it were a doggy in the untamed outdoors..

To attain the result of successfully kennel training a puppy, the size of the kennel, its structure, as well as the materials it is made up of, are very important and vital together with, the basic principle that the kennel, shall not be used to reprimand the pup in any way what so ever. The pup from the very start needs to learn to trust the kennel and not be scared of it.

The kennel should be purchased prior to you bringing the new puppy home for the first time. Pick a size that would not facilitate the dog to frolic about.

A large number of skilled trainers stipulate that the kennel ought to fit as explained above, at all ages of the puppy. This suggests that a different kennel should be bought every two months or so, till the doggy is completely grown.

It most advisable to obtain a crate that is meant for an adult dog of its breed, but partition it to suit the puppy's present size, changing the partition as the dog grows, until the partition is no longer needed.

It must be kept in mind that a dog will never poop in its sleeping quarters, therefore the size of the kennel need to just be enough for resting space only, if the kennel is going to be used to house break the dog effectively.
